A Cubic Meter per Hour (m³/h) is a unit of volumetric flow rate used to measure the volume of fluid passing through a given surface per unit time. It represents how many cubic meters of a substance flow in an hour. This unit is commonly applied in contexts such as water supply, chemical processing, and other industrial applications where understanding the flow rate is crucial for system efficiency. Definition of Milliliter/secondA Milliliter per Second (mL/s) is a unit of volumetric flow rate that quantifies the volume of liquid moving through a surface in one second. It helps ascertain the precise amount of fluid flow in applications requiring fine measurement, such as medical dosing, laboratory experiments, and small-scale industrial processes. Cubic Meter/hour (m³/h) | Milliliter/second (mL/s) |
---|---|
0.001 m³/h | 0.278 mL/s |
0.01 m³/h | 2.78 mL/s |
0.1 m³/h | 27.78 mL/s |
1 m³/h | 277.78 mL/s |
10 m³/h | 2777.78 mL/s |
20 m³/h | 5555.56 mL/s |
50 m³/h | 13888.89 mL/s |
100 m³/h | 27777.78 mL/s |
200 m³/h | 55555.56 mL/s |
500 m³/h | 138888.89 mL/s |
1 m³/h = 277.78 mL/s
1 mL/s = 0.0036 m³/h
Example 1:
Convert 5 m³/h to mL/s:
5 m³/h = 5 × 277.78 mL/s = 1388.9 mL/s
Example 2:
Convert 3.5 m³/h to mL/s:
3.5 m³/h = 3.5 × 277.78 mL/s = 972.23 mL/s

What is the conversion factor from Cubic Meter/hour to Milliliter/second?
The conversion factor is 277.78, meaning 1 m³/h equals 277.78 mL/s.
